Service & reparation Request a quoteThe MUVE B330 is a continuous measurement biological tracer and sample collector system specifically designed for unmanned aerial systems (UAS). The system enables real-time monitoring of biological threats. Building on the proven design and performance of the IBAC product line, the B330 features a configuration optimized for size, weight, and power consumption. Designed for use on the SkyRanger R70 and R80 drones, the detector is intuitive, easy to use, and requires minimal maintenance. The sensor display is integrated with the pilot’s Mission Control Station (MCS) and provides real-time information on alarm status and sample collection. This ensures that the pilot is immediately alerted to potential threats while also receiving confirmation that samples are being collected correctly.
The MUVE B330 contributes by enabling remote identification of biological threats.

Technical specification
Technology: UV Laser Induced Fluorescence (LIF)
Sample Introduction Airborne particles; triggered aerosol sample collector
Sample Phase Aerosol; flow rate 4.0 L/min (0.14 ft3/min)
Threats Spores, vegetative bacteria, viruses, and toxins; particle size: 0,7 – 10 microns
Sensitivity: <100 particles/liter of air
Sampling & Analysis: Continuous
Sample Collection: Integrated sample collection
Display & Alerts: Mission Control Station (MCS)
Outputs: Alarm Status, Diagnostics Status, Collector Status
Power: 16-36 VDC, 10W, 12W (collector running)
Cold Start Time: <5 mins
Operating Temp: -32 to 49°C
Operating Humidity 5% to 99%, non-condensing
Integrated Sample Collector Specifications
Sampling Method Dry collection
Power: 2 watts
Max Flow: Rate 30 L/min
Particle Size: 1 to 10 microns
Collection Media: Sample Disk
Sample Recovery: Sample extraction from sample disk in vial with liquid buffer
Communication: Ethernet
Physical Features
Dimensions: 193 x 193 x 216 mm
Weight 1440 gram
Enclosure: Composite polyamide based, carbon filled
